Graduates into Teaching Pathway
Location:
Schools across Sunderland
Role:
Teaching Assistant (Paid Internship)
Duration: 3 months to 1 year
Start Date:
Immediate starts available
- Support pupils both in small groups and one‑to‑one across secondary, SEN and primary schools.
- Work closely with experienced teachers and support staff to deliver high‑quality learning experiences.
- Gain practical classroom experience while developing essential skills in behaviour management, lesson planning and pupil support.
- Be placed in schools close to your home for convenience.
- A degree in any subject with a minimum 2:2 classification (or predicted).
- GCSEs in Maths and English at grade C/4 or above.
- Strong communication and presentation skills.
- A proactive and adaptable attitude in a fast‑paced school environment.
- A genuine passion for education and working with young people.
- Two referees we can contact as part of the application process.
- A valid DBS certificate on the Update Service or willingness to apply for one.
- Paid Classroom
Experience:
Earn a salary while building practical teaching skills over a period of 3 months to 1 year. - Ongoing Support and Training:
Access free training and support from our specialist team, including an opportunity to achieve an accredited Level 2 qualification. - Cost‑Free Programme:
There are no fees to join – it’s a fully‑funded pathway into teaching. - Career Progression:
Strengthen your CV with tailored application support and a personalised video profile to enhance your appeal to future employers. - References and Mentorship:
Receive valuable references from your placement schools and expert advice on your next steps into teacher training. - Making a Difference:
Contribute meaningfully to pupils’ learning and personal development, making a positive impact from day one.
